搜索到与相关的文章
Java

Java NIO(十一)Pipe

JavaNIO管道是2个线程之间的单向数据连接。Pipe有一个source通道和一个sink通道。数据会被写到sink通道,从source通道读取。这里是Pipe原理的图示:创建管道通过Pipe.open()方法打开管道。例如:Pipepipe=Pipe.open();向管道写数据要向管道写数据,需要访问sink通道。像这样:Pipe.SinkChannelsinkChannel=pipe.sink();通过调用SinkChannel的write()方法,

系统 2019-08-29 22:04:18 2343

编程技术

开发 Visual Web JSF 应用程序

在本教程中,您将使用NetBeansIDE和JSF1.2(Woodstock)组件创建并运行一个简单的Web应用程序:HelloWeb。该样例应用程序将让您输入一个姓名,然后显示一条包含该姓名的消息。首先,使用一个输入字段来实现此页面。然后,使用下拉列表替换该输入字段,用户可以在该下拉列表中选择姓名。该下拉列表中将被填充某数据库表中的姓名。预计时间:25分钟目录创建项目设计页面添加一些行为运行应用程序使用“下拉列表”替换“文本字段”设置数据库将“下拉列表”

系统 2019-08-12 09:30:31 2343

Java

Java程序之内存简单分析

对于不同的系统,程序运行内存的分配可能略有不同,这里只以最基本的4块做介绍。堆内存(Heap)是用于动态给new出来的对象分配空间(每个对象大小不定),堆内存比较大;对象的引用(一般在方法体内,new对应之后赋给一个引用),可以看成局部变量,在stack中分配空间(即栈内存);基础类型变量只分配一块内存(stack),引用类型变量占两块内存(heap,stack)。①Load到内存区(程序----我们编写的代码是存在硬盘上面的);②找到main方法开始执行

系统 2019-08-12 09:30:09 2343

编程技术

iPhone开发入门篇 “Hello World”分析代码

本篇将介绍了HelloWorld程序的分析代码,也就是到底这个程序是怎么sayHello的.本文非常适合尚未入门的开发者,希望各位iPhone应用程序开发的初学者喜欢。每个学习程序开发的第一个程序都是“HelloWorld”,作为刚刚入门的iPhone应用程序开发者,掌握“HelloWorld”的分析代码是十分重要的。本篇将介绍了HelloWorld程序的分析代码,也就是到底这个程序是怎么sayHello的。这个程序基本的运行顺序是:载入窗口(UIWind

系统 2019-08-12 09:30:03 2343

编程技术

nginx 源码学习笔记(十四)—— 全局变量ngx_c

再打算正式开始研究core模块式,发现有一个很重要的变量ngx_cycle_t,一直伴随,如果不懂ngx_cycle可能读起代码来回非常困难,这里就来详细学习一下吧。本文大部分灵感来自于。http://blog.csdn.net/livelylittlefish/article/details/7247080和http://blog.sina.com.cn/s/blog_677be95b0100iivi.html谢谢作者提供很详细的资料。依照惯例我们直接来

系统 2019-08-12 09:29:51 2343

编程技术

Animation Timing

一:AnimationTimingCurves1:LinearAnimationTiming2:Ease-InAnimationTiming3:Ease-OutAnimationTiming4:Ease-InEase-OutAnimationTiming5:CustomAnimationTiming自定义动画执行曲线设置WecreateacustomtimingwiththeinitWithControlPoints::::methodonCAMediaT

系统 2019-08-12 09:29:50 2343

各行各业

Flume研究心得

最近两天,仔细的看了一下Flume中央日志系统(版本号:1.3.X),Flume在本人看来,还是一个非常不错的日志收集系统的,其设计理念非常易用,简洁。并且是一个开源项目,基于Java语言开发,可以进行一些自定义的功能开发。运行Flume时,机器必须安装装JDK6.0以上的版本,并且,Flume目前只有Linux系统的启动脚本,没有Windows环境的启动脚本。Flume主要由3个重要的组件购成:Source:完成对日志数据的收集,分成transtion和

系统 2019-08-12 09:27:12 2343

各行各业

[Selenium]Grid模式下运行时打印出当前Case在哪

当Case在本地运行成功,在Grid模式下运行失败时,我们需要在Grid模式下进行调试,同时登录远程的node去查看运行的情况。Hub是随机将case分配到某台node上运行的,怎样知道当前的case是运行在哪台node上呢?可以通过这段代码获取node的信息:publicvoidgetComputerNameOfNode(WebDriverdriver){Stringhub="SZAUTOTEST1";intport=4444;HttpClientBui

系统 2019-08-12 09:26:47 2343

Oracle

Oracle table problem

最近遇到一个奇怪的Oracle问题:Oracle数据库里面有一个表,在查询表的varchar2类型的column时总是查找不到正常的结果,查询其他类型的column可以返回正常结果。简化的例子如下ID列的类型为numberNAME列的类型为varchar2(10)里面的数据如下:(1,'94'),(2,'94'),(3,'testname')select*fromTestTablewhereid=1能返回正常结果select*fromTestTablewh

系统 2019-08-12 01:55:43 2343